Admission for Master of Law (LLM) Course

A Master of Law (LLM) is a postgraduate degree in law that provides advanced legal education and specialization in a particular area of law. This degree is pursued by individuals who have already completed their undergraduate law degree (LLB or JD) and want to deepen their understanding and expertise in a specific legal field. In this article, we will discuss various aspects of LLM course admissions, including eligibility criteria, application process, required documents, selection criteria, and tips for a successful application.

Eligibility Criteria for LLM Course Admission:

Before applying for an LLM program, it is essential to meet certain eligibility criteria set by the respective universities or institutions. The general eligibility criteria for LLM course admission may include:

  1. Educational Qualifications:

    • Completion of a Bachelor of Laws (LLB) degree or an equivalent law degree from a recognized university or institution.
    • Some universities may require a certain minimum percentage or grade in the LLB program for eligibility.

  2. Work Experience (Optional):

    • Some LLM programs may prefer or require candidates to have prior work experience in the legal field, although this is not always a mandatory requirement.

  3. Language Proficiency:

    • Proficiency in the language of instruction (usually English) is important. Non-native English speakers may need to provide proof of language proficiency through tests like TOEFL or IELTS.

Application Process for LLM Course Admission:

The application process for an LLM program typically involves several steps, including:

  1. Research and Program Selection:

    • Research various LLM programs offered by different universities and choose the ones that align with your interests and career goals.

  2. Prepare Application Materials:

    • Gather all the necessary documents, such as academic transcripts, letters of recommendation, statement of purpose, and curriculum vitae (CV).

  3. Complete Online Application:

    • Fill out the online application form provided by the university or institution offering the LLM program. This form usually requires personal information, academic history, and program preferences.

  4. Submit Required Documents:

    • Upload or submit the required documents, which may include transcripts, degree certificates, letters of recommendation, statement of purpose (SOP), curriculum vitae (CV), and any other documents specified by the university.

  5. Pay Application Fees:

    • Pay the application fees, if applicable. Some universities may charge a nominal fee for processing the application.

  6. Submit Test Scores:

    • If required, submit standardized test scores such as the GRE, GMAT, TOEFL, or IELTS, depending on the university's requirements.

  7. Interview (if required):

    • Some universities may require candidates to participate in an interview as part of the selection process.

  8. Check Application Status:

    • Keep track of your application status through the university's application portal. Universities usually provide updates on the admission decision within a specific timeframe.

Required Documents for LLM Course Admission:

When applying for an LLM program, certain essential documents need to be submitted to complete the application. These documents typically include:

  1. Academic Transcripts and Certificates:

    • Official transcripts and certificates from all educational institutions attended, including the undergraduate law degree.

  2. Letters of Recommendation:

    • Usually 2-3 letters of recommendation from professors, employers, or legal professionals who can attest to the candidate's academic abilities and potential.

  3. Statement of Purpose (SOP):

    • A well-written statement of purpose that outlines the candidate's motivation for pursuing the LLM program, career goals, and how the program aligns with those goals.

  4. Curriculum Vitae (CV) or Resume:

    • A comprehensive CV or resume detailing academic and professional achievements, work experience, internships, publications, and any relevant activities.

  5. Test Scores (if required):

    • Scores of standardized tests such as GRE, GMAT, TOEFL, or IELTS, if required by the university.

  6. Passport Copy (for international applicants):

    • A copy of the passport for international applicants to verify their identity and nationality.

Selection Criteria for LLM Course Admission:

Universities and institutions offering LLM programs consider various factors to select candidates for admission. The selection criteria may include:

  1. Academic Performance:

    • Academic achievements and performance in previous law studies, particularly in the LLB or equivalent program.

  2. Professional Experience (if applicable):

    • Relevance and duration of work experience in the legal field, if required or considered in the admission process.

  3. Letters of Recommendation:

    • Quality and relevance of the recommendation letters provided by referees, emphasizing the candidate's suitability for the LLM program.

  4. Statement of Purpose (SOP):

    • Clarity of purpose, alignment with the chosen LLM program, and articulation of career goals are demonstrated in the SOP.

  5. Test Scores (if required):

    • Performance in standardized tests such as GRE, GMAT, TOEFL, or IELTS, if mandated by the university.

  6. Interview Performance (if applicable):

    • Assessment of the candidate's communication skills, knowledge, and enthusiasm for the LLM program during an interview, if conducted.

  7. Diversity and Inclusivity:

    • Universities may seek diversity in the student body, considering factors such as nationality, cultural background, and professional experience.
